1. The sooner the sale occurs, the higher for the group
Commissioner Rob Manfred had an replace on the sale of the Angels in the course of the Winter Meetings, as he mentioned the league is hopeful that the method might be accomplished by Opening Day. According to Manfred, potential consumers have already been given monetary data, which is an enormous step within the sale course of.
If the Angels can full a sale earlier than Opening Day (and even early within the season), it can enhance their probabilities of re-signing two-way famous person Shohei Ohtani to an extension, as a result of the brand new possession would have time to promote Ohtani on the way forward for the franchise.
It’s finally as much as Ohtani what he desires to do, however having new possession in place would give the Angels a greater probability of retaining him. He is likely to be tempted to check free company both means, as there have already been rumors swirling about him doubtlessly getting a contract value greater than $500 million.
Minasian mentioned that Ohtani reaches out to him usually in the course of the offseason to speak concerning the additions the membership makes and what it is seeking to do. It reveals Ohtani is engaged with the membership and desires to see it put a winner on the sector, which is one thing that hasn’t occurred since he arrived in 2018.
2. The Angels aren’t finished including to the roster
Even after signing Drury, there are nonetheless holes to fill, and the Halos will proceed so as to add gamers they assume match the roster. They had been by no means prone to go after high-priced shortstops Carlos Correa, Trea Turner, Xander Bogaerts or Dansby Swanson, however they’ve improved their infield depth. Drury is anticipated to now see time at second base, and so they can rotate David Fletcher and Luis Rengifo at shortstop, with Livan Soto and Andrew Velazquez additionally within the combine.
The Angels are additionally probably so as to add at the least one other reliever and will purchase a sixth starter as effectively. Estévez is anticipated to be the nearer, however the membership may use extra aid depth, and including a veteran starter would make a variety of sense.
